    A lot of Flacco pundits fail to grasp that the offense that is run in Bmore is completely different as the Pats/Saints/Packers.. even Steelers. It is a WINNING offense... It aint pretty, and probably not what most fans want. Now its very debatable whether it can win a SB (the #1 seed Chargers in 2006/7 lost a tough one with a conservative Cam gameplan), but no one can argue that it doesnt win games. Not even an elite QB in this system will put up numbers. Joe is very good at what the Ravens want their QB to do in their system, so you cannot simply compare QB stats to determine what Joe is worth. Considering that... its an absolute no-brainer to the organization.

    They could always get Flacco done during the season. Other teams do that, sometimes even with big contracts. That's what the Bills did with Fitzpatrick.
    I hope it doesn't come to that. Both sides have equal leverage over the summer. Once the season starts - and Joe has to be subjected to the possibility of injury before his big payday - then a lot of players (and AGENTS!) figure why not roll the dice and hit free agency?

    The franchise number is just too big to mess around with like that, IMO.

    Plus, with Fitzpatrick - whose contract looks like a pretty big mistake right now - there was an unknown quantity to him, where he sort of came out of nowhere to play so well (and the Bills may have been foolish to buy). With Flacco, this moment has been coming for 3 years now. It's time.
